Office network (Windows Server 2000-Active Directory, Windows Server
2003-faxing program, client computers running Vista Business). Keep getting a
DCX output error when the Vista users attempt to fax, but check out these
results:

1. The DCX issue appears only when the users (1, 2) sign on to their OWN
computers.
2. The DCX issue DOES NOT occur when user 1 signs on to user 2's computer
and vise versa.
3. The DCX issue DOES NOT occur when any other user sings on the 1 and/or
2's computer.
4. The DCX issue DOES NOT occur when users 1, while using its own
computer, right clicks and selects "Run as Administrator" (inputting the
username/password of the network administrator). Same for user 2.
5. This DCX issue DOES NOT occur when users 1 and/or 2, while using their
own computers, have their network privileges elevated to Domain Admin status.

I just don't get it. All I can surmise is that there maybe a program,
installed by users 1 and/or 2, that is causing this. Any help would be
appreciated.
